McDonough Turf Conditions

McDonough's clay-based soil is both a blessing and a curse. It's stable for construction, which is why subdivisions thrive here, but it's terrible at letting water percolate naturally. During Georgia's wet springs and sudden summer thunderstorms, that clay becomes a sponge with nowhere to drain. When we install artificial turf in Eagle's Landing or Kelleytown, we always account for this by building in a base system with proper slope and a perforated drainage layer underneath. Sun exposure varies depending on your lot's size and tree coverage—newer subdivisions tend to have fewer mature trees, meaning more direct sun and faster-drying synthetic surfaces. Older neighborhoods near Heritage Park often have bigger oaks and shade patterns that change seasonally. We assess each yard individually. Most McDonough lots are quarter-acre to half-acre residential properties, which is perfect for synthetic turf installation. HOA rules in some Eagle's Landing communities require specific turf grades or pile heights, so we always verify before recommending materials. The clay also means we avoid traditional underpad systems that trap moisture; instead, we use engineered drainage bases that let water flow through and away from your foundation.

Why is my yard staying wet longer than my neighbor's in McDonough?

Henry County clay doesn't drain naturally like sandy or loamy soil. If your neighbor's yard sits slightly higher or slopes better, water runs off faster there. Standing water in clay is extremely common in McDonough. Artificial turf with proper drainage base solves this—we slope the ground 1-2% and install a perforated drainage layer that moves water away quickly, even in heavy rain.

How long does drainage repair and turf installation typically take in McDonough?

Most residential yards in McDonough take 3-5 days from start to finish, depending on lot size and drainage complexity. We remove old grass, regrade for slope, install the drainage base and turf, and finish landscaping.
